Book 2014Latest editionted towards practical implementation of optical network design. Algorithms and methodologies related to routing, regeneration, wavelength assignment, sub rate-traffic grooming and protection are presented, with an emphasis on optical-bypass-enabled (or all-optical) networks. This chapter presents a brief history of optical networking and an overview of its current state. Additionally, it discusses relevant research trends, to provide insight into future optical networking advancements.Irrigate 发表于 2025-3-22 14:22:30
